Transaction 184231fa30c24ee1c5c23c1b59396c9761795aee4984af836f523a454bb95c65
1 Input
1 Output
-
184231fa30c24ee1c5c23c1b59396c9761795aee4984af836f523a454bb95c65:0
- value
- 30479
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04f8b9bd4492bc596830b9e30e9d179541bde13e OP_EQUAL
- address
- 329Jb4iSVpN8WTk1xQ25AoA1Nk8LPBmfXM